Output ae93b264421d5505865602bfeb0b4bc6d2c28b667f11091ed29f38f01b2d5a88:1

value
34100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8d531c7e805fcda5960dc4222a280533a2601f OP_EQUAL
address
3MymEYE4EgbnBoRq9s3aGgMuc5QZmLFZ4n
transaction
ae93b264421d5505865602bfeb0b4bc6d2c28b667f11091ed29f38f01b2d5a88
confirmations
271924
spent
true